I have XP with the nvidia Geforce GT 7900 and FSX Acceleration installed. The result was that I also had the freezes and system crashes due to the same driver bug that others have described in similar posts. I downloaded the latest beta driver ver 169.28_forceware_xp_32bit_beta.exe installed it and I do NOT have the problem any longer Get the newest driver fron nvidia web downloads and install it. If you are still having problems, I suggest you write nvidia and have them address this issue.
